Description of the tree image in section 5.11.1 of the "Metadata Vocabulary for Tabular Data" document
The anyAtomicType
(any
) datatype breaks down into subtypes as follows:
anyURI
base64Binary
(binary
)boolean
date
datetime
(datetime
), which can be sub-typed as adateTimeStamp
decimal
, which can be sub-typed as aninteger
, further classifiable as one oflong
, which can be further defined asint
, even further describable asshort
, with a subtypebyte
nonNegativeInteger
, which can be further defined as one ofpositiveInteger
unsignedLong
, even further describable asunsignedInt
, with a subtypeunsignedShort
, which has a further subtypeunsignedByte
- or
nonPositiveInteger
with a subtypenegativeInteger
double
(number)duration
which can be further sub-typed as adayTimeDuration
oryearMonthDuration
float
gDay
gMonth
gMonthDay
gYear
gYearMonth
hexBinary
(binary
)QName
string
, which can be sub-typed as one ofnormalizedString
, further classifiable as atoken
, which can be further defined as one oflanguage
Name
NMtoken
xml
html
json
time